🥘 Ingredients

14 items
  • 4 pieces whole wheat tortillas
  • 120 grams cream cheese
  • 1 piece lime
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 0.5 teaspoon cumin pow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 100 grams sweet corn kernels
  • 100 grams black beans
  • 1 piece red bell pepper
  • 50 grams baby spinach leaves
  • 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ro
  • 1 piece jalapeño
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on pepper

📝 Instructions

12 steps
1

In a small mixing bowl, combine the cream cheese, juice of one lime, smoked paprika, cumin powder,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Mix thoroughly until well combined and set aside.

2

Rinse and drain the black beans. Rinse the sweet corn kernels if using canned, or steam them if using fresh corn.

3

Finely dice the red bell pepper and jalapeño. Be sure to deseed the jalapeño if you prefer less heat.

4

Chop the fresh cilantro leaves finely and set aside.

5

Lay one tortilla flat on a clean surface or cutting board.

6

Spread a generous layer of the seasoned cream cheese mixture evenly over the tortilla, reaching all edges.

7

Sprinkle a thin layer of sweet corn kernels, black beans, diced red bell pepper, and jalapeño over the cream cheese.

8

Add 5-6 baby spinach leaves and a sprinkle of fresh cilantro on top of the vegetables.

9

Tightly roll the tortilla from one end to the other, creating a neat roll.

10

Repeat the process for the remaining tortillas and filling ingredients.

11

Using a sharp knife, slice each roll into 1-inch thick pieces to create bite-sized pinwheels.

12

Arrange the roll ups on a serving platter. Serve immediately or refrigerate for up to 2 hours before serving.
